UCM Education is looking for an experienced SEN Teacher to join a full-time position in a supportive secondary SEN school located in Southwark. The role involves working with a class of 7 pupils with varied communication needs, including those using iPads and core boards.

The ideal candidate will have Qualified Teacher Status and experience in special education support. Responsibilities include:

  • Planning differentiated learning
  • Collaborating with staff
  • Maintaining a positive classroom environment
